This is a solo work in the sense that all of the compositions were written, and instruments played by Bill Burke. Most tracks achieve a multiple instrument sound, or band sound through multi-tracking and use of guitar synthesizers. You will hear nylon and steel string acoustic and electric guitars, bass, mandolin, piano, cello, flute, sax, voice, sitar, koto, and assorted percussion. The tempos and mood varies from composition to composition. It is difficult to select a style for classification because many are represented. There is world music, string music, rock, jazz, acoustic, all mixed in. Melody is king. The original artwork is from paintings by Naila Parveen. (Naila.Art.com).Jaanji opens the album with the theme played on a Japanese koto obtained during a community fundraiser after the tsunami. Two other variations later appear featuring percussion and electric guitar. Amma's Shooting Star was written after seeing a star flash across the December night sky; the track features guitar and cello. The electric guitar soars on Hurricane Island, You Are My Country, and At Peace; jazz guitar on The Whole World and Naila. The sounds of a storm morph into Like Rain Falling. The title track, Shelter No.3 - a place where magical things happen, features acoustic guitar and percussion. Mandolin and sax are featured respectively on Transcendence and My Treasure Chest; acoustic guitar on Mera Dil Mari Jaan and Chimes in the Wind; vocals on Go Figure and You Float Through Me, and sitar on You Are My Country and Naila.
